Secondary Operator - 3rd shift
On-site · Lake Geneva, Wisconsin, United States
Job Summary
Operate and assist with secondary manufacturing processes on 3rd shift at the Lake Geneva facility. Set up and tend equipment used in secondary operations, perform in-process inspections to ensure quality, follow written work instructions, blueprints, and production documentation, and complete production paperwork and traveler documentation accurately. Monitor machines for failures, notify supervisors or Quality when nonconformances are identified, and assist with sorting, packing, labeling, and handling finished products. Maintain a clean, organized, and safe work area while following all safety policies. Secondary operations may include trimming, grinding, welding, heat shrinking, washing, pad printing, and other secondary manufacturing processes. Physical requirements include standing, repetitive motions, occasional stooping/kneeling, and lifting up to 50 pounds. Schedule is 3rd shift (5 days a week, 10:00 PM – 6:30 AM) with $2.00/hr shift differential.
Required Qualifications
- High school diploma or GED preferred
- Manufacturing experience preferred, but willing to train the right candidate
- Ability to read and follow written instructions
- Basic mechanical aptitude and tool knowledge
- Ability to read customer blueprints preferred
- Strong attention to detail and quality
- Comfortable working in a fast-paced manufacturing environment
